THOM PAIN (BASED ON NOTHING) Announces Additional Extension
by Julie Musbach
- Nov 14, 2018
The Signature Theatre production of Thom Pain (based on nothing), by Drama Desk Award-winning playwright Will Eno and directed by Obie Award-winner Oliver Butler, has been extended by a week for a second time, the company announced today. The production, which stars Golden Globe Award-winner Michael C. Hall ("Dexter," "Six Feet Under," The Realistic Joneses), will now run through December 9, 2018.
Annie Golden, Thom Sesma, and More to Feature in THE ENCHANTED COTTAGE
by Julie Musbach
- Nov 13, 2018
Gingold Theatrical Group is proud to announce the final presentation of the 13th Season of Project Shaw, a special series of evenings offering some of Shaw's greatest works and those who share his fierce 'art as activism' precepts, presented monthly at Leonard Nimoy Thalia at Peter Norton Symphony Space (2537 Broadway at 95th Street). The acclaimed 2018 season will conclude on December 17th with Shaw contemporary Arthur Wing Pinero's The Enchanted Cottage.

Thom Yorke Releases Fifth Track Off Of Upcoming SUSPIRIA Album
by Kaitlin Milligan
- Oct 25, 2018
The sublime piano and vocal melodies at the center of "Unmade" signal the fifth and final song to be released in advance of Thom Yorke's Suspiria (Music for the Luca Guadagnino Film). "Unmade" follows previous advance offerings "Open Again," "Volk," "Has Ended,' and the first piece of music to emerge from the soundtrack, "Suspirium"-described by The New York Times as "sweetly chilling" and Rolling Stone as 'peak Yorke, and scary good.'
